Passive income can close that gap and deliver money while you are sleeping.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-92230\" src=\"https:\/\/www.biggerpockets.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/drivingfordollars-1.jpg\" alt=\"\" width=\"702\" height=\"472\" title=\"\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.biggerpockets.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/drivingfordollars-1.jpg 702w, https:\/\/www.biggerpockets.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/drivingfordollars-1-300x202.jpg 300w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 702px) 100vw, 702px\" \/><\/p>\n<h2>Tax Benefits<\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Real estate comes with many organic tax benefits, breaks, and write-offs. However, once you get started, you&#8217;ll realize that active income from real estate (i.e. flipping houses) can be taxed at very high rates. Tax rates on passive income and long-term capital gains can be much lower, which makes a big difference in net gains. Buy-and-hold investors can also use vehicles like <a href=\"https:\/\/www.forbes.com\/forbes\/welcome\/?toURL=https:\/\/www.forbes.com\/2010\/01\/26\/capital-gains-tax-1031-vacation-home-personal-finance-robert-wood.html&amp;refURL=https:\/\/www.google.com\/&amp;referrer=https:\/\/www.google.com\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">1031 exchanges<\/a> and self-directed retirement accounts to pay even less taxes.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2>Freedom<\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Life is short.
